Why Fort Walton Beach Homes Get Dirty Faster Than You'd Think
Fort Walton Beach sits right on the Gulf of Mexico. That location is beautiful. It also means your home fights salt air, high humidity, and fine sand almost every day of the year.
Coastal humidity creeps into bathrooms and kitchens. Mold and mildew build up fast, especially in tile grout and around window frames. Salt residue settles on surfaces near the coast.
Homes along Santa Rosa Sound and near the Marler Bridge area see constant moisture. Homes further inland, near Kenwood or Garnier Road, deal more with seasonal pine pollen and general dust.
Fort Walton Beach also has a strong military presence around Eglin Air Force Base. Base housing and nearby neighborhoods like Shalimar see heavy foot traffic and families that need reliable, recurring upkeep.
Vacation rentals and short-term properties on Okaloosa Island turn over constantly. Move-out and move-in cleans are in high demand throughout the year, not just in summer.
The climate here runs hot and wet from spring through fall. Screens, vents, and ceiling fans collect dust and pollen quickly. Regular cleaning is not optional — it's practical maintenance.
Typical House Cleaning Prices in Fort Walton Beach
| Cleaning Type | Typical Price | What's Included |
|---|---|---|
| Standard / Recurring Clean | $100 – $180 | Dusting, vacuuming, mopping, bathrooms, kitchen surfaces, trash |
| Deep Clean | $200 – $400 | Everything in standard plus baseboards, ceiling fans, inside cabinets, scrubbing tile and grout |
| Move-In / Move-Out Clean | $250 – $500 | Full deep clean of empty home, inside appliances, closets, all surfaces |
| Post-Construction Clean | $300 – $600+ | Debris removal, dust from every surface, windows, floors, fixtures |
| One-Bedroom Home or Condo | $100 – $160 | Scaled standard or deep clean based on size and condition |
| Add-Ons (oven, fridge, interior windows) | $25 – $75 each | Inside oven cleaning, inside refrigerator, interior window washing |
Every price depends on your home's size, layout, and current condition. You'll see your exact quote before you book — no surprises at the door.

Standard, Deep, Move-Out & Post-Construction Cleaning in Fort Walton Beach
Not every clean is the same job. Here is the honest difference, from cleaners who do this every day:
- Standard clean — your regular upkeep: kitchen surfaces, appliance fronts, stovetop and sink, bathrooms fully wiped and disinfected, floors swept and mopped, dusting, vacuuming, and trash taken out. Best on a home that is already maintained.
- Deep clean — everything in a standard clean, plus the detail work: baseboards, window sills, blinds dusted, hard-water buildup on faucets, shower doors and grout scrubbed, ceiling fans, inside the microwave, and (on request) inside the fridge and oven. This is what a first-time or long-overdue clean needs.
- Move-out clean — the same deep-clean detail on an empty home, aimed at getting your deposit back: empty cabinets, inside appliances, window tracks, and baseboards.
- Post-construction clean — after a remodel or new build, when fine drywall dust coats everything. A careful wall-to-floor process, priced for the extra work.

How House Cleaning Is Priced in Fort Walton Beach
Honest pricing depends on the size and condition of your home, not a flat guess. Bigger homes and deeper cleans take longer, and a well-maintained place on a recurring plan costs less per visit than a first-time deep clean. You get a clear estimate up front.
What makes a clean take longer (and cost more): a home that has never had a professional clean, pets — especially on carpet, small children, and heavy clutter. We factor these in honestly instead of lowballing and then upcharging on the day.
Rough time on site: a standard clean usually runs 2 to 3½ hours; a deep or move-out clean 4½ to 6½ hours; post-construction longer. That way you can plan your day.
Supplies: our pros bring their own professional-grade supplies and equipment. Prefer a specific product for a certain surface? Leave it out and we will use it.
What's Included in Each Clean: Basic vs. Deep vs. Move-Out
Here is exactly what each type of clean covers, so you can pick the right one:
| Task | Basic | Deep | Move In/Out |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sweep, vacuum & mop | ✓ | ✓ | ✓ |
| Wipe countertops & backsplash | ✓ | ✓ | ✓ |
| Wipe down all surfaces, tables & stands | ✓ | ✓ | ✓ |
| Vacuum carpets & area rugs | ✓ | ✓ | ✓ |
| Wipe appliance exteriors | ✓ | ✓ | ✓ |
| Wipe fridge exterior | ✓ | ✓ | ✓ |
| Clean stovetop | ✓ | ✓ | ✓ |
| Clean microwave | ✓ | ✓ | ✓ |
| Clean sinks | ✓ | ✓ | ✓ |
| Clean toilets | ✓ | ✓ | ✓ |
| Clean bathtubs / showers | ✓ | ✓ | ✓ |
| Clean mirrors | ✓ | ✓ | ✓ |
| Empty & wipe trash cans | ✓ | ✓ | ✓ |
| Wipe handles & light switches | — | ✓ | ✓ |
| Dust window sills / ledges | — | ✓ | ✓ |
| Wipe baseboards | — | ✓ | ✓ |
| Dust / wipe vents | — | ✓ | ✓ |
| Dust / wipe ceiling fans | — | ✓ | ✓ |
| Clean cabinets / drawers (exterior) | — | ✓ | ✓ |
| Wipe cabinets & drawers (interior) | — | — | ✓ |
| Clean fridge / freezer (interior) | — | — | ✓ |
| Clean oven (interior) | — | — | ✓ |
| Wipe down door frames | — | — | ✓ |
A move-out clean is the most thorough — it adds the inside of cabinets, the fridge, the oven, and door frames on top of a deep clean.
